Man, Armed with Table Leg, Robs Store at San Bruno Mall: Police
Police say the man threatened employees with the object.

SAN BRUNO, CA – A Bay Area man is behind bars Friday, suspected of stealing from a store at the Tanforan Mall while armed with a table leg, police say.
According to San Bruno Police Lt. Troy Fry, 49-year-old Marcel Criner of Pittsburg, was arrested on suspicion of robbery, possession of narcotics and on outstanding warrants following the incident at 11:04 a.m. Wednesday.
Fry says police got a call regarding a person "armed with some type of bat" who had committed a theft at the mall.

"A subsequent investigation revealed the subject... had taken items from a store within the mall and threatened employees with a table leg as he fled," Fry said in a news release.
Responding officers caught up with Criner, who was arrested at the scene, police said.

Jail records indicate the suspect was being held at the Maguire Correctional Facility on multiple felony and misdemeanor charges.
